In today's lesson, you will learn how to model and plan a stage production for "The Wizard of Oz." You will set up your model to easily switch between scenes and view from different angles. Using scenes allows you to see a top-down view and the audience's perspective to ensure your set looks good. The move tool helps you make copies of objects like chairs to plan seating arrangements. You will also learn to create custom set pieces using images from online or a camera. To start, open a new SketchUp model and use the rectangle tool to create a 40 feet by 25 feet stage.
